spring boot2.0原理
时间: 2023-04-05 16:00:39 浏览: 101
Spring Boot 2.0 是一个基于 Spring 框架的开源框架,它的主要原理是通过自动配置和约定大于配置的方式,简化了 Spring 应用的开发和部署。它提供了很多开箱即用的功能,如内嵌的 Tomcat、Jetty 和 Undertow 服务器、自动配置的数据源、缓存、安全等等。同时,Spring Boot 2.0 还支持多种构建工具,如 Maven 和 Gradle,使得开发者可以更加方便地构建和管理项目。
相关问题
spring boot2.0授权方式原理
Spring Boot 2.0 的授权方式原理是基于 OAuth2.0 协议实现的。OAuth2.0 是一种授权框架,它允许用户授权第三方应用程序访问他们存储在另一个服务提供者上的资源,而不需要将用户名和密码提供给第三方应用程序。Spring Boot 2.0 中的授权方式可以通过配置 OAuth2.0 的客户端和服务器来实现。客户端可以通过访问授权服务器来获取访问令牌,然后使用访问令牌来访问受保护的资源。授权服务器可以验证客户端的身份,并授予访问令牌,以便客户端可以访问受保护的资源。
Spring BOOT参考文献
以下是几本关于Spring Boot的参考文献:
1. 《Spring Boot实战》 - 作者:Craig Walls
2. 《Spring Boot in Action》 - 作者:Craig Walls
3. 《Spring Boot Cookbook》 - 作者:Alex Antonov
4. 《Spring Boot Up and Running》 - 作者:Mark Heckler
5. 《Spring Boot 2 Recipes》 - 作者:Marten Deinum
6. 《Spring Boot Microservices with Docker and Kubernetes》 - 作者:Ranga Rao Karanam
7. 《Spring Boot 2 Fundamentals》 - 作者:M. P. Nag
8. 《Spring Boot 2.0 Projects》 - 作者:Mohit Gupta
9. 《Spring Boot 2.0 Cookbook》 - 作者:Alex Antonov
10. 《Spring Boot 2.0 Projects》 - 作者:Mohit Gupta
这些书籍涵盖了Spring Boot的技术、实践和原理,可以帮助开发者更好地理解和应用Spring Boot。